<ins draggable="n862y"></ins><dfn dropzone="_bo5c"></dfn><noframes dir="cykax">
<acronym dropzone="9lcvfq2"></acronym><acronym id="jxb_yh0"></acronym><ins dir="4xurej0"></ins>

TPWallet置换全景指南:防温度攻击、合约安全与未来趋势(含稳定性与备份)

在TPWallet进行置换(Swap)时,用户的目标通常是“以更优价格、在可接受风险下完成交易”。但在真实环境里,价格、滑点、MEV/抢跑、合约风险与网络波动会共同影响结果。下面从“防温度攻击、合约安全、市场未来趋势、新兴技术支付系统、稳定性、定期备份”六个维度做一份尽量全面、可落地的讨论。

一、防温度攻击(以及相关对抗思路)

1)什么是“温度攻击”的直观含义

“温度”在很多交易对抗语境中常被用来描述某种“交易意图被感知后,市场执行层被用来加热/冷却”的行为学概念。例如:在链上环境中,攻击者通过预先探测或预测你的交易参数(路由、数量、滑点容忍、期限、签名可见性等),从而采取抢跑、夹击或操纵价格的方式,让你的置换在你提交后仍“被更差的执行结果”。

2)常见可利用点

- 交易参数可预测:你固定用同一滑点、同一路由、同一金额区间,容易被“归类”。

- 广播与执行时间差:从签名到链上确认之间存在延迟,攻击者可能利用这段窗口实施抢跑。

- 过宽的滑点容忍:允许的偏离越大,越容易被夹击。

- 可重复的操作节奏:同一时间规律性置换,容易触发“监控—反制”。

3)应对策略(不等同于绝对安全)

- 合理设置滑点:不要默认用过大的滑点。建议根据代币波动与流动性深度设定。深度越小、波动越大,滑点需要更谨慎的平衡,而不是一味增大。

- 缩短交易期限/避免长挂单窗口:如果你的置换机制支持“截止时间”,尽量缩短,以减少被盯上的时间窗口。

- 分散策略与金额拆分:在流动性不足或极易被抢跑的市场,拆分可以降低单笔被精确对冲的概率。但拆分也会带来更多手续费与滑点累积,需权衡。

- 避免机械化重复:改变路由或使用不同的交易对(在价格合理的前提下),降低被模型化预测的可能。

- 确认路由与最小接收量(minOut):若工具提供“最小接收”功能,确保它与自己的预期价值匹配。minOut越严格,越能抵御“价格被拉扯后仍成交”的风险,但也可能提高失败率。

二、合约安全:你在“置换”时实际面对的风险

TPWallet本质上是交互入口。真正完成兑换的是DEX路由/交易对合约、代币合约(转账逻辑)、以及可能的聚合路由器合约。合约安全要从“代币合约层—路由/交易层—执行环境层”一起看。

1)代币合约层风险

- 费税/通缩(Tax/Deflationary)代币:你看到的“到账数量”可能与预期不一致,滑点会被放大。

- 非标准ERC20实现:某些代币使用非标准返回值,可能导致交互异常或路由失败。

- 权限与可升级性:检查代币合约是否存在可更改交易规则的权限(如owner可升级、可调整tax、黑名单/白名单限制)。

2)DEX/路由合约层风险

- 合约权限:路由器或池子是否存在可暂停交易、可更改费率、可迁移流动性等管理权。

- 池子/流动性状况:小池子更容易被操纵,价格冲击与夹击风险更高。

- 路由复杂度:路由越多跳数(multi-hop),失败与滑点累计的风险越大。

3)执行环境层风险

- 链上拥堵与Gas波动:如果你的交易在队列中等待时间过长,市场可能已经变化。

- 价格预言与滑点失效:即便DEX报价是“当下”,你成交时的真实状态可能已偏离。

4)可落地的安全检查清单(建议每次置换前)

- 核对合约地址是否为官方或可信来源(避免“同名假合约”)。

- 查看代币是否存在转账限制(黑名单、授权转账、最小/最大转账限制)。

- 优先选择流动性深、交易历史清晰的交易对。

- 使用工具提供的“最小接收量/交易保护”参数。

- 不要盲签高权限:确认授权(Approve)额度是否必要,且尽量设为“只够使用”。

三、市场未来趋势剖析:置换将如何被重塑

1)聚合器与路由优化更“智能”

未来更可能出现:

- 更细粒度的路径选择:根据实时流动性、手续费与滑点动态选择路由。

- 更主动的风险定价:将夹击概率、MEV环境、以及失败率纳入报价。

- 更强调“最小接收保护”和执行质量(execution quality)。

2)MEV与对抗机制持续演化

用户需要理解:MEV并不会消失,而是会被产品级别的策略部分缓解。例如交易打包、隐私保护、交易重排序抑制等理念会逐渐进入主流钱包交互体验。

3)跨链与L2流动性分层

资产流动性将呈现分层:

- 某些链/L2上的深度更高,置换成本更低。

- 跨链桥与同步延迟可能引入额外风险与成本。

因此未来“选择链上环境”本身会成为置换策略的一部分。

4)监管与合规的间接影响

虽然链上资产并不等同于传统金融监管对象,但平台与接口可能在合规层面收紧,从而影响可用路由、风控策略与部分代币可见性。用户应关注工具对交易的限制策略变化。

四、新兴技术支付系统:从“置换”走向“支付网络化”

当下“支付系统”不再只是转账或刷卡,而更像一个由多层能力组合而成的网络:

- 钱包侧:统一资产管理、价格与路由聚合、签名与授权控制。

- 协议侧:可组合的支付指令(如分账、订阅、条件支付)。

- 隐私/安全侧:更强的交易保护与权限最小化。

未来可能更常见的方向包括:

1)意图(Intent)与任务式交易

用户描述“我要买多少/用最小成本完成”,系统再决定执行路径与时序。这会减少用户直接面对复杂路由与参数的负担,但也要求更透明的执行规则与可验证的报价。

2)链上支付与现实结算结合

支付系统会更强调与业务场景结合,例如商户收款、发票/凭证、以及多币种自动换汇。

3)抽象账户与更人性化的支付体验

账户抽象可能使Gas、失败重试、批量操作更顺滑,间接降低用户在“置换失败—重新操作”的心理与成本。

4)更普遍的安全合约模板与审核机制

随着主流钱包把合约交互做成模块化组件,会出现更多“经过验证”的交换路径与安全执行框架。

五、稳定性:网络、报价与失败恢复

1)网络稳定性

- 观察链上拥堵:在高峰期降低大额或降低失败成本。

- 选择合适的Gas策略:太低可能长时间排队,太高则成本不经济。

2)报价稳定性(市场微观结构)

- 小流动性池:价格跳动会更快,滑点更难控制。

- 波动高的时段:尽量避免在剧烈行情中“硬执行”。

3)失败恢复策略

即便做了保护,仍可能因:gas、路由失败、最小接收触发、状态变化导致交易回滚。

- 理解失败类型:是签名被拒、授权失败、还是路由执行失败。

- 保持记录:记录交易哈希、时间、参数(尤其是minOut/滑点/路由)。

- 复核余额:失败交易不代表你资产一定没变化,需确认代币是否已被授权或扣除。

4)对账户与授权的稳定性管理

授权(Approve)往往是一种长期风险暴露。建议:

- 仅在需要时授权;

- 尽量使用最小额度;

- 定期检查授权列表并清理不必要权限。

六、定期备份:把“操作能力”变成“可恢复能力”

定期备份是安全与稳定的最后一公里。无论是助记词、私钥、还是交易记录,都需要“可恢复”。

1)备份内容建议

- 助记词/密钥:离线保存、多份存储,避免网络化暴露。

- 钱包导入信息:确保你能在不同设备上恢复。

- 交易记录与关键参数:建议保存在加密笔记或离线文档中(交易哈希、时间、路由、minOut、滑点、合约地址)。

- 授权记录:定期整理你授权过的合约及额度(尤其是Approve)。

2)备份频率

- 新增重要资金后:立即备份。

- 重要操作后:如开启大额置换、授权新合约、切换网络/钱包设备。

- 固定周期:例如每月或每季度复核一次备份是否可用、是否完整。

3)备份的安全存放原则

- 离线优先:避免把助记词明文保存在云同步/截图里。

- 分散保管:不要把所有备份集中在单一地点。

- 防止钓鱼:备份的任何形式都不要在来历不明的“安全检查页面”中输入。

结语

TPWallet置换并不只是一键换币。真正的差异来自:你如何设置交易保护参数、如何识别合约与代币风险、如何在变化的市场中控制滑点与执行质量、如何用授权与备份机制降低长期暴露。把“防温度攻击、合约安全、市场趋势、新兴支付技术、稳定性、定期备份”形成闭环,你的置换体验将更可预测,风险也更可管理。

(提示:以上内容为安全与策略讨论,不构成投资建议。链上交互存在不可逆风险,任何操作请在充分理解后进行。)

作者:沈岚风发布时间:2026-05-18 06:29:31

评论

AidenChen

把“温度攻击”讲得很形象,滑点/最小接收量/期限这些点也直接能用上。

小岚回声

合约安全部分很到位:代币费税、非标准ERC20、以及授权最小化我以前容易忽略。

NovaKai

对稳定性与失败恢复写得实用,尤其是记录交易参数和确认余额这条。

林暮澄

市场未来趋势那段我喜欢,聚合器更智能和MEV对抗会持续演化确实是趋势。

MiaZhou

定期备份写得像清单一样,离线优先+分散存放的原则很关键。

CarlosWei

新兴支付系统从置换延伸到意图与账户抽象的逻辑很顺,读完有方向感。

相关阅读
<i lang="lcx5"></i><tt id="1aur"></tt>
<address lang="zxt"></address><em lang="92h"></em><u draggable="bxl"></u><del id="xk5"></del><map lang="yrj"></map><legend id="d49"></legend>